#7EC0FD Color Information

#7EC0FD RGB value is (126, 192, 253). The hex color red value is 126, green is 192, and blue is 253. Its HSL format shows a hue of 209°, saturation of 97 percent, and lightness of 74 percent. The CMYK process values are 50 percent, 24 percent, 0 percent, 1 percent.
